a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orKeith <keith@rhizomatica.org>2016-12-22 19:18:18 +0100
committerHarald Welte <laforge@gnumonks.org>2016-12-24 17:12:34 +0000
commit80abe522e2ddc979d994530f21b103808fc465d7 (patch)
treebabceebcd10cc1381be5508f09557c878839b39d
parent532480a705726452ace30b1a914640d984dd0418 (diff)
Pass actual smpp_avail_status through to smpp in alert_all_esme()
-rw-r--r--openbsc/src/libmsc/smpp_openbsc.c4
1 files changed, 2 insertions, 2 deletions
diff --git a/openbsc/src/libmsc/smpp_openbsc.c b/openbsc/src/libmsc/smpp_openbsc.c
index 0269f4b3b..228e61dfe 100644
--- a/openbsc/src/libmsc/smpp_openbsc.c
+++ b/openbsc/src/libmsc/smpp_openbsc.c
@@ -263,11 +263,11 @@ static void alert_all_esme(struct smsc *smsc, struct gsm_subscriber *subscr,
if (esme->acl && esme->acl->deliver_src_imsi) {
smpp_tx_alert(esme, TON_Subscriber_Number,
NPI_Land_Mobile_E212,
- subscr->imsi, 0);
+ subscr->imsi, smpp_avail_status);
} else {
smpp_tx_alert(esme, TON_Network_Specific,
NPI_ISDN_E163_E164,
- subscr->extension, 0);
+ subscr->extension, smpp_avail_status);
}
}
}